What It’s Like to Work With Us
Structured & Low-Arousal
Our approach is calm, deeply respectful and structured to reduce anxiety through predictability and Positive Behaviour Support (PBS).
Meaningful Skills & Growth
You will support daily routines, build life skills, use visual communication tools (AAC, Makaton) and celebrate small wins that mean everything.
Comprehensive Training
We invest heavily in our staff with Autism-specific training, sensory regulation, PBS, medication competency and clear career pathways.
